"IMMACULATELY PRESENTED END TERRACED PROPERTY!! This property has been renovated to a very high standard which is sure to impress any buyer. The living room has solid wooden flooring and an ultra modern glass sided staircase with solid ash wooden stairs. The kitchen has a range of extremely high quality units with granite work surfaces and integrated double oven, hob, dishwasher and fridge freezer. Upstairs there are two bedrooms which both have fabulous quality fitted wardrobes, drawers and dressing tables. The bathroom is fantastically fitted and presented. Externally there is a good size yard with gate access to the side. No expense has been spared in the refurbishment of this property, viewings are essential.

GROUND FLOOR

Living Room13'10" x 13'4" (4.22m x 4.06m). This very modern living room is perfectly decorated and has a centre ceiling light point, ceiling spotlights, double glazed window to the front, radiator, gas fire, solid wooden flooring, the stairs are beautifully crafted and have an ultra modern glass side and metal rail.

Kitchen/Diner13'5" x 9'6" (4.1m x 2.9m). This room is sure to impress any viewer and has been upgraded to a very high standard. Fitted with a range of stylish wall and base units with granite work surfaces, integrated double oven, gas hob, fridge freezer and a dishwasher, double glazed window and a door to the rear.

FIRST FLOOR

Landing One ceiling light point.

Bedroom One13'10" x 13'4" (4.22m x 4.06m). Fitted with a range of perfectly fitted wardrobes, drawers and a dressing table this room is an excellent double room and has a double glazed window to the front and a radiator.

Bedroom Two12'4" x 8' (3.76m x 2.44m). Situated at the rear of the property, this room also has fitted wardrobes, drawers and a desk/dressing table, d double glazed window to the rear and a radiator.

Bathroom Ceiling spotlights, double glazed window to the rear, bath with a shower over, wash basin with vanity storage and a WC.

OUTSIDE To the rear is a good size yard with gate access to the side.
